One of the most prominent examples is India Uncut, a long-standing blog by Amit Varma that offers critical commentary on Indian governance and societal shifts.

If you are looking to create or follow an informative "uncut" post in this space, here are the key themes currently trending: 1. The "Demographic Dividend" vs. Economic Reality

Recent discussions center on the gap between India's young population and the availability of high-quality jobs. Analysts often highlight that without systemic reform, this potential strength could become a significant social burden. 2. Digital Identity and Privacy

With the expansion of digital public infrastructure (like UPI and Aadhaar), there is a growing "uncut" dialogue regarding:

Accountability: How state power increases through data collection.

Citizen Rights: Shifting the perspective from being "subjects" of government digital tools to "citizens" with privacy rights. 3. Cultural Representation in New Media

The rise of "Desi" content creators on platforms like TikTok and Facebook has led to a surge in "uncut" or "behind-the-scenes" coverage of:

Regional Cinema: Raw footage from trailer launches and movie sets that bypass traditional PR filters.

Emerging Talent: Highlighting independent theater and niche arts that don't always make mainstream headlines. 4. Policy and Governance

Thought leadership in this niche often tackles "normalized failures" of the state, such as: The long-term impact of price controls on essential goods.

Persistent issues like childhood malnourishment that remain critical despite technological advancements.
